LAS VEGAS – Tarita Allenker defeated Vanessa Demopros in a unanimous decision on Saturday to open a spare card at the UFC Apex in Las Vegas.

Let’s take a look at the fight against Allenker, who returned to his victory column after his first loss in a rematch with Stephanie Luciano this August.

Talita Alencar def. Vanessa Demopoulos

result: Talita Alencar def. Vanessa Demopoulos by Unanous Decision (30-26, 30-27, 30-27)
Updated Records: Alencar (6-1 MMA, 2-1 UFC), Demopoulos (11-7 MMA, 5-4 UFC)
Important statistics: Alencar has four takedowns, which led to more than 12 minutes of ground control time.

Alencar about key moments in the battle

“Undoubtedly, I improved on something impressive. I definitely got better in every area. I was happy to be able to dance a little with my hands. We got a knockout there with one of the combos we were training throughout the camp.

Alencar about being ready for anything

“But I’m training to get involved in the UFC, not for specific opponents. I’m studying my opponents whenever I need them. But I know this division is packed in, so I’m training to get a hard fight.”

Alencar about what she wants next

“I’m definitely going to take a week off. … I’m here. The UFC can call me. I’ve now told my manager that I have zero damage right now, and I already have a Nevada license: Come on, three times this year (I want to fight). I’ve been in Brazil for a long time. I need to see my family.

“Everything we did in camp, we took action.”
